Replacement Window Costs - The cost for replacing windows generally 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, material, and style. For example, a standard double-pane window might cost around $450 each, including installation.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ific project requirements.

Material Expenses - Different window materials influence overall costs, with vinyl options typically costing less than wood or fiberglass. Vinyl windows may cost between $250 and $700 each, while wood frames could range from $600 to $1,200 per window. Material choice impacts both initial investment and long-term maintenance.

Labor and Installation Fees - Installation costs can vary from $150 to $500 per window, influenced by factors like window size and existing structure. Complex or custom installations t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um, with local service providers able to offer precise quotes. Proper installation is key to ensuring energy efficiency and durability.

Additional Costs to Consider - Extra expenses may include removing old windows, upgrading window sills, or sealing for energy efficiency, which can add several hundred dollars to the project. Budgeting for these potential costs helps ensure a comprehensive understanding of total expenses involved. Local contractors can assist in assessing specific project needs and cost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How long do replacement windows typically last? The lifespan of replacement windows varies based on materials and installation quality, but many can last 15 to 20 years or more with proper maintenance.

Are there different types of replacement windows available? Yes, options include vinyl, wood, aluminum, and composite windows, each offering different styles and performance features.

What should I consider when choosing replacement windows? Factors to consider include energy efficiency, style, durability, and compatibility with the existing structure, along with consulting local service providers for advice.

Can replacement windows improve my home's energy efficiency? Yes, modern replacement windows can help reduce energy costs by providing better insulation and sealing against drafts.
